Peel the butternut squash and cut into cubes that are slightly larger than a dice.
In a medium size bowl, add the squash and mix with the olive oil, ground cinnamon, salt and pepper.
Spread the butternut squash on a baking sheet that's been covered with either aluminum foil or parchment paper.
Bake the squash in the oven for 30 minutes.
After 30 minutes, remove the baking tray from the oven and add the cranberries. Return the tray to the oven and continue cooking for another 10-15 minutes or when the cranberries start to slightly burst.
Remove the baking tray from the oven and sprinkle the feta cheese on top.
Drizzle with the honey right before serving.
Notes
Make sure the butternut squash is on a flat, stable surface before cutting.
